In cell A19 type-in Net Income. Next, adjust the width of column A.
Click-on cell C19.
In cell C19 we want to subtract ( - )the amount in for Expenses in cell C17 from the amount for Income in cell C9. This can be accomplished by using either the Type-In Method or Point Method. Go ahead and do this. Don’t forget to tap the Enter key to confirm your formula.
The formula should look like =C9 C17
